Property Description for 13 Russell Street

Welcome to 13 Russell Street Brooklyn, an outstanding three-family building in the heart of Greenpoint-Williamsburg, offering more than 4,100 gross square feet in a well-maintained 20-foot by 55-foot building with an English basement and large backyard, positioned on a spacious 20-foot by 100-foot lot. With its impressive footprint and excellent condition, this fine building provides endless possibilities for owners who can choose to occupy one of the large lofty units while earning a substantial income from the other two. Or owners can create a magnificent single-family home within the expansive proportions. For investors, the three-unit building is a turnkey opportunity to begin earning income right away. And, with the L train at Graham just 10 minutes from the front door, residents enjoy easy two-stop access to Manhattan. The beautiful, sun-splashed units each enjoy loft-like open floor plans, updated interiors, generous closet space, bay windows and bright eastern, southern, and western exposures. Wonderful architectural details, including hardwood floors, soaring ceilings and handsome original millwork, add warmth and charm. Washing machine in two units. The first-floor unit includes one bedroom and bathroom, plus a home office, spacious dining room, living room and a sunny corner kitchen. The top two units boast two-bedroom, one-bathroom layouts, and the huge walkout basement delivers considerable usable square footage, a separate entrance and level access to the sprawling backyard. A gated forecourt adds wonderful curb appeal to this exceptional Brooklyn townhouse. Perfectly positioned where Greenpoint meets Williamsburg, this three-unit building is surrounded by Brooklyn's best shopping, dining, nightlife, arts, and live music venues. Catch a show at nearby Brooklyn Steel or Warsaw and explore the many local cocktail lounges and buzzy destination restaurants. Less than two blocks away, McGolrick Park offers a seasonal farmer's market, playground, and dog run, while gorgeous McCarren Park features a pool, tennis courts, fitness center, track and year-round greenmarket. Greenpoint | Brooklyn

Quick Profile

Go north, not west. Greenpoint’s placement at the furthermost tip of Brooklyn makes it peak “North Brooklyn” territory. Bordered by the East River, its geographical location has long made Greenpoint integral to maritime activity, present day ferry service to Manhattan included. With Williamsburg to the south and Long Island City to the north, Greenpoint’s “hip factor” often experiences crossover traffic from these areas. 

Particularly bustling on the weekend, the edge of McCarren Park at Bedford Avenue and Lorimer Street filters out into prime Greenpoint, where brunch has become a hallowed tradition for newer and longtime residents alike. Bars and restaurants such as Spritzenhaus and Five Leaves also provide close proximity to a post-dining jaunt in the park. 

As the neighborhood continues to grow and develop, the old world feel of a tradition of Polish immigrants has commingled with the arrival of enterprising millennials that have become a part of the go-getting spirit of the neighborhood. Filled with small coffee shops, vintage boutiques and award-winning restaurants (as well as tailored bars like TØRST offering up specialty beers on tap), Greenpoint truly is the jewel of North Brooklyn.
